Geometry Meets Art

Students in Mrs. Nolen’s Geometry class have begun their creative art projects using compasses, straightedges, and their knowledge of geometric constructions. We can’t wait to see their final masterpieces — stay tuned for the finished products! 💙🖤

High School Awards for 24-25 LEAP Scores

On Friday, September 26th, Stanley High School recognized high school students for their outstanding performance on the LEAP 2025 end-of-year assessments, CLEP exams, and AP exams from the 2024–2025 school year.

Students were honored for their achievements in English, Math, Science, and Social Studies and received certificates of recognition for their hard work and dedication. Students also received recognition for attendance for the first nine weeks of school.

To celebrate their accomplishments, students were invited to participate in a Water Day celebration held on Friday, October 4th—a fun afternoon of music, games, and well-deserved enjoyment in recognition of their academic success.

In addition, students who earned a 3.5 cumulative GPA or higher with no disciplinary referrals were invited to join Stanley’s only honor club, BETA. These students exemplify the values of leadership, achievement, and service that define true Panther excellence.

Stanley High School is proud of these students for their commitment to excellence and for setting a great example of Panther pride!
